These Chablis vineyards are located in the most northern part of the Bourgogne wine region and were established towards the end of the 9th century by the monks from the Pontigny Abby.
In those days the Chablis made a good mass wine. Now, Phillippe Goulley produces fantastic wines and has been producing in the Chablis region since 1991.
Unoaked Chardonnay with vibrant acidity, a distinctly accessible Chablis with a lengthy finish.
This Petit Chablis has a lightish golden hue with good balance and the typical bone-dry, minerally flavour of the region.
